A Failure of Usual Sorts Of Prenups for Cohabiting Partners



Cohabiting companions have a number of types of prenuptial contracts at their disposal, each made to address specific circumstances and requirements. The very first is a building agreement, which describes the department of possessions and financial debts in instance of separation. The second is an assistance contract, laying out possible financial obligations like spousal support (Prenuptial agreement Ontario). There's an extensive prenup that incorporates components of both residential or commercial property and assistance agreements. Last but not least, cohabiting partners can select a sundown condition prenup, which gradually nullifies the see this page agreement after an established duration. Each kind serves an one-of-a-kind objective, giving defense and Flat fee prenuptial agreement clearness for both parties. However, it is important to recognize these kinds extensively prior to determining which best fits their situation.

Lawful Difficulties and Usual Misunderstandings Concerning Prenups



Browsing the legal surface of prenuptial agreements frequently offers many challenges, even more made complex by common misconceptions. One misconception is that prenups are entirely for the well-off, producing a barrier for couples with moderate possessions. However, these arrangements can shield any kind of person's current and future assets. An additional legal obstacle hinges on making sure full financial disclosure, as concealing assets can bring about the arrangement being rejected by the court. Additionally, a prevalent myth is that prenups constantly secure the wealthier event, however actually, a well-drafted contract should give advantages to both celebrations. Last but not least, an arrangement perceived as grossly unreasonable can be opposed in court, highlighting the requirement for knowledgeable lawful advice in the production of a prenup.
